What is a Self-Emptying Robot Vacuum?
Self-emptying robot vacuums are designed to clean your floors autonomously while managing their dust and dirt collection without much intervention. When the vacuum returns to its docking station after cleaning, it empties its integrated dustbin into a larger bag or bin, generally holding a number of weeks' worth of debris. This feature not just provides convenience but also lowers the frequency of maintenance required by the user.

Suction Power:
The effectiveness of a vacuum mostly depends on its suction power, typically measured in Pascal (Pa). Higher suction power equals better efficiency on carpets and in getting dirt.
Battery Life:
Robot vacuums differ in battery life. Consider your home size and the vacuum's typical cleaning period.
Mapping Technology:
Advanced mapping and navigation systems improve cleaning performance by guaranteeing the robot understands where it has already cleaned. Try to find models with smart technology, such as LiDAR or video cameras.
Flooring Surface Compatibility:
Check if the vacuum is fit for different kinds of flooring, whether it be carpets, wood, or tiles.
Dustbin Capacity:
Self-emptying vacuums use a larger dustbin at the docking station. Evaluate how often it will need emptying based on your household's specific requirements.

A lot of dust bags can hold numerous weeks' worth of debris, depending on the amount of traffic in your home. Usually, it will require to be cleared every 30 to 60 days.

4. How loud are self-emptying robot vacuums?
Noise levels normally vary from 55 to 70 decibels, making them quieter than traditional vacuums. Lots of brand names provide requirements relating to noise levels.
